With the aim of raising the profile of writers committed to values such as the culture of peace, freedom of expression and freedom of creation, the PEN Català and the CCCB are launching a series of conversations between different authors and their translators.

Vera Pàvlova and Xènia Dyakonova

Letters to the next room

Vera Pavlova, one of the most important poets in Russian literature, talks to writer and translator Xenia Dyakonova about her literary career and the influence of her work on subsequent generations.

Denise Desautels and Antoni Clapés

Literature: to translate or to be translated

Denise Desautels, one of the most important voices in contemporary Quebec poetry, talks to the poet Antoni Clapés, her translator into Catalan, about their shared literary connections.

Petros Màrkaris and Quim Gestí

Greece... what now?

The writer Petros Markaris, a great modern-day storyteller and a leading figure in European crime novels, talks to Quim Gestí, his translator into Catalan for over twenty years, about the relationship between his literary work and the craft of translating.
